Transaction 308b0060d117aea345bcddfdcdff8d9711c8170114d677d80a2a878b39530707
1 Input
1 Output
-
308b0060d117aea345bcddfdcdff8d9711c8170114d677d80a2a878b39530707:0
- value
- 1400796
- script pubkey
- OP_0 OP_PUSHBYTES_20 8be4c38d56fad1390781db234d6fadfe5437fe81
- address
- bc1q30jv8r2kltgnjpupmv356madle2r0l5pq8keq0